Frequently Asked Questions
Are American Bobtails good with other pets?
Yes, American Bobtails are sociable and generally get along well with other pets.
How much grooming do Ojos Azules require?
Ojos Azules have a grooming difficulty level of 2, indicating moderate grooming needs.
Do both breeds adapt well to apartment living?
Yes, both American Bobtails and Ojos Azules are apartment-friendly.
What is the lifespan of these breeds?
American Bobtails typically live between 13 to 15 years, while Ojos Azules have a lifespan of 12 to 15 years.
Are these breeds suitable for first-time cat owners?
Yes, both breeds are considered good for first-time owners due to their friendly and adaptable nature.
